Operation “Blue Star” is the only event in the history of Independent India where the state went into war with its own people. Even after about 40 years it is not clear if it was culmination of states anger over people of the region, a political game of power or start of dictatorial chapter in the democratic setup.
The people of Punjab felt alienated from main stream due to denial of their just demands during a long democratic struggle since independence. As it happen all over the word, it led to militant struggle with great loss of lives of military, police and civilian personnel. Killing of Indira Gandhi and massacre of innocent Sikhs in Delhi and other India cities was also associated with this movement.
Botswana College of Distance and Open Learning Library Orientation-Maun
1. Botswana College of Distance
and Open learning(BOCODOL)
Library Orientation
BY ASSISTANT LIBRARIAN
B.N. HULELA
2. Background Information
Thamalakane Life-Long Learning Centre Library is a
growing Library established to support distance
learning programmes offered by the College. Its
operations began in July 2011.
The library aims at building a diverse collection
aimed at addressing information needs of its clients.
3. The objectives of the Library
To develop a dynamic collection that support
educational, research activities of the college.
Provide high quality, user centred services to distance
learners based on understanding their needs.
Provide integrated access to library collection and
information and creativity applying accepted
standards.
Stay abreast and employ technological innovation for
betterment of the service.
Help learners to acquire library skills, critical
thinking, study and information literacy.
4. Library Opening Hours
Hours of operation are as follows:
Monday – Friday 7:30 am - 4:30 pm
During tutorials 8:00 am – 5pm
During examination 7:30 am – 8pm(Monday to Friday) and
8:00am – 5pm Saturday and Sunday
Closed at lunch time
5. Collection
The library has a growing collection of over 1300 books and 660
BOCODOL module books. The library started with a collection of
249 books.
There is a browsing collection of information books and fiction
books and dvds,cds available for checkout.
Books are arranged by Dewey decimal classification. You need the
entire class/call number to locate the book on the shelf.
Non- circulating collection:
Journals
Newspapers
Newsletters/magazines
Botswana Collection
Reference collection
Students projects and past exam papers
BOCODOL modules

7. Circulation Procedures
By virtue of being a BOCODOL student or staff , you
are automatically a member of the library.
However, in order to borrow our materials you
will be required to complete an application form
available at the library(we need a proof of
registration or employment letter).
Borrowing Entitlements
Staff 6 items - materials circulate for 30 days
Learners 4 items- materials circulate for 30 days
Magazines and past exam papers are housed at the
circulation desk(not for circulating).
8. Services
Lending service- customers with borrowing
privileges must present acceptable identification at
the circulation desk to check out library materials.
Renewal is allowed only if the material is not
reserved for another person. Renewal can be done
once in the library or through telephone, email .
Patrons must confirm new due date and write it on
the date slips in ink.
Reservations service- items on loan can be
reserved. The client will be informed as soon as
items are returned. Holds are placed for 3 days
9. Services cont.….
Reference service – The library provides patrons
with information to address their information needs.
Internet Access Service/Electronic searches- We
provide access to the internet during the library open
hours . The Library staff conduct online searches for
computer illiterate patrons.
Current Awareness Service – Patrons are provided
with information on current issues that are relevant to
their needs.
Inter Library Loan- If we do not have an item in our
stock, we may request it from other libraries for our
clients.
Information Literacy- The Library offers library
and information skills.
10. Overdue/Lost materials
All Library users are encouraged to return library
materials on time. ordinary loan will be charged
50t per material and reserved material is P1.00 per
material.
It is the responsibility of the borrower to take care
of library materials. The user is expected to pay for
lost library material, current replacement value +
25% handling charges. Recovered materials will not
be accepted if the user has already paid.
11. Facilities
Computer workstation-13 computers with access to
internet and Microsoft office
35 Study carrels
Study tables(44 users)
Lounge suite (for newspaper reading)
Discussion room
Board room
Librarian’s office(reference room)
12. Rules and Regulations
Observe silence in the library.
Eating, drinking, chewing or smoking is prohibited in the library.
Mute your cell phone while in the library.
No bags are allowed in the library.
Security personnel must check all items coming in and out of the
library.
The library is not responsible for the patron’s personal property.
Please do not bring your children and pets in the library.
Library property should not be vandalized.
Library chairs should not be reserved for any users.
Computers are to be used for research purposes and any viewing
of pornographic material is forbidden.
Reference materials can only viewed inside library(not for
circulation).
